Output 43f38f93f278763e4189ac2a689db95fd7af59d77d99589291e35f6a9a0d78ec:0

value
1037247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bf6aeed0e2eba2e4df4ecd34a2adb9fb011c0af OP_EQUAL
address
3FugB8itpLUkdhC23YNBNpiDZeUhHHzf8n
transaction
43f38f93f278763e4189ac2a689db95fd7af59d77d99589291e35f6a9a0d78ec
confirmations
375681
spent
true